For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 164 students in Thackerville, OK.
The top-ranked public preschool in Thackerville, OK is Thackerville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Thackerville, OK public preschool have an average math proficiency score of 25% (versus the Oklahoma public pre school average of 29%), and reading proficiency score of 22% (versus the 27% statewide average). Pre schools in Thackerville have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Oklahoma public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 40%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Oklahoma public preschool average of 57% (majority Hispanic).
